Ensinger Tecapeek® CF30 Polyetheretherketone, 30% Carbon Reinforced (PEEK)
Categories: Polymer; Thermoplastic; Polyketone; Polyetheretherketone (PEEK)

Material Notes: Tecapeek™, made from Victrex® PEEK polymer, is an excellent material for a wide spectrum of applications where thermal, chemical, and combustion properties are critical to performance.
  • Excellent flexural, impact, and tensile characteristics
  • Very high continuous working temp
  • Very high heat distortion temp
  • Exceptional chemical resistance
  • Superior dielectric at high temperatures and frequencies
  • Good radiation resistance
  • Outstanding wear and abrasion resistance
  • Low smoke and toxic gas emissions
  • Excellent hydrolysis resistance

Physical PropertiesMetricEnglishComments
Density 1.44 g/cc0.0520 lb/in³ASTM D792
Water Absorption 0.060 %0.060 %at 24 hours; ASTM D570
 
Mechanical PropertiesMetricEnglishComments
Hardness, Rockwell M 107107ASTM D785
Tensile Strength, Yield 186 MPa27000 psiASTM D638
Elongation at Break 1.1 %1.1 %ASTM D638
Tensile Modulus 12.999 GPa1885.4 ksi1 % Sec; ASTM D638
Flexural Strength 318 MPa46100 psiASTM D790
Flexural Modulus 12.755 GPa1850.0 ksiTangent; ASTM D790
Compressive Strength 240 MPa34800 psiASTM D695
Shear Strength 97.2 MPa14100 psiUltimate; ASTM D3846
Izod Impact, Notched 0.481 J/cm0.900 ft-lb/inASTM D256
Coefficient of Friction, Dynamic 0.220.221200 in/min, 155 lbs Load; ASTM D1894-95
Limiting Pressure Velocity 13.5 MPa-m/sec385000 psi-ft/min1200 in/min
 
Electrical PropertiesMetricEnglishComments
Volume Resistivity 140000 ohm-cm140000 ohm-cmASTM D257
 
Thermal PropertiesMetricEnglishComments
CTE, linear 14.4 µm/m-°C
@Temperature 20.0 °C
8.00 µin/in-°F
@Temperature 68.0 °F
ASTM D696
Thermal Conductivity 0.918 W/m-K6.37 BTU-in/hr-ft²-°FASTM C177
Melting Point 334 °C633 °F
Maximum Service Temperature, Air 260 °C500 °FContinuous
Deflection Temperature at 1.8 MPa (264 psi) 316 °C600 °FASTM D648
Flammability, UL94 V-0V-0
